Events
- January 26 - The science-fiction serial Quatermass and the Pit concludes on BBC Television in the UK with 11 million viewers for the final episode, a recent BBC record.
- April 24 - The Your Hit Parade television series, which has been on the air since 1935 in its earlier radio form, airs its last episode.
- September 12 - Bonanza airs as the first weekly television series broadcast completely in color.
- Hanna Barbera's first television cartoon, Huckleberry Hound premieres.
